Re: Code comparison with Rybka, Houdini, then Chiron
comparing is hell a lot of work especially when done on executeable basis. So it's only done when there is a lot of suspicion. Show to the public your well grounded suspicion about Chiron and it will be checked, be sure. But so far I haven't seen anything that looks suspicious. Believe me, almost all engines are checked. The discussion that is visible here in our forum is just about those engines that look suspicious.
